Hi guys!
I got an email from them as well. They will give you a 1 time fee of $5 for each image they choose. That's it. No royalties. In my case they wanted roughly 200 images so that would mean an upfront payment of $1000.
I haven't decided what to do because most of the images they want make me A LOT more than $5/year on the big 5.
It's also an ethical question as to all the $$$ this company will be doing with my images for years to come (if they last that long) and me getting nothing but a measly $5.

Absolutvision has been around for a long time.
I have worked with them in the past. The oldest part of my portfolio is there.
They will require to view thumbs of your images and then choose they ones they like. They
will not accept any garbage quality images. You just give them the right to sell your images only through their main website and pay you a one time fee of 5$ for it ( you would think that after all these year they would offer more than 5$ :) )
I would only recommend it to those in great need of money right away.
